Chris Anderson (trumpeter)

From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Chris performing in Amsterdam in 2007

Chris Anderson is a trumpet player with Southside Johnny and the Asbury Jukes.[1] He is a regular performer with Bobby Bandiera and has released his own CDs. He was in the 'Orquest 88' with Hector Lavoe.

Discography

  • Southside Johnny & the Asbury Jukes – Pills and Ammo (2010) – Trumpet
  • Southside Johnny & the Asbury Jukes – Into The Harbor (2005) – Trumpet
  • Southside Johnny & the Asbury Jukes – Going To Jukesville (2002) – Trumpet
  • Various Artists – A Very Special Christmas 5 (2002) – Trumpet
  • Southside Johnny & the Asbury Jukes – Superhits (2001) – Trumpet
  • Southside Johnny & the Asbury Jukes – Messin' With The Blues (2000) – Trumpet
